Transferring your site
You can hand your whole site to another Site Star account. The new owner gets the site and its settings and takes over the plan. It's done with a private invite link.

Open Transfer site
Make sure you're on the Website tab, then open Settings in the sidebar and click Ownership. The Transfer site card is there.
Create the invite link
Before you do, here's what moves and what stays:
- The new owner gets the site and its settings.
- Your account keeps the old conversation history. It is not copied to them.

Or do it yourself in the Site Star dashboard
Click Create transfer link.
What the new owner does
The person you send the link to opens it while signed in to their own Site Star account, then accepts:
- They see Accept [your site]? with the site's name.
- If the site is on a paid plan, they choose which card pays for it (Choose payment, then Accept and continue) before the move begins. For a free site there's no payment; they just click Accept transfer.
- Once done, the site moves into their account, and they can open it right away.
